On this episode of Applaudable Perspectives, Pam is joined by musician, producer, and engineer Joe Hand. Born in New York and raised in South Florida, he fell in love with music, watching people on TV in music studios. Hand knew he wanted to be making music at twelve years old, grew up a classical pianist, and ultimately found his home at Berklee College of Music. Tune in to hear more about his journey from his early years in music to now.
